esp.c: only raise IRQ in esp_transfer_data() for CMD_SEL, CMD_SELATN and CMD_TI commands
Clarify the logic in esp_transfer_data() to ensure that the deferred interrupt code can only be triggered for CMD_SEL, CMD_SELATN and CMD_TI commands. This should already be the case, but make it explicit to ensure the logic isn't triggered unexpectedly.
